Red Cat Holdings, Inc. (Nasdaq: RCAT) is a cutting-edge drone technology company revolutionizing the landscape of aerial and multi-domain intelligence for military, government, and commercial applications. Through its wholly owned subsidiaries—Teal Drones and FlightWave Aerospace—Red Cat develops and manufactures the Arachnid Family of Systems, including advanced ISR platforms like Black Widow, TRICHON, and the FANG series, along with unmanned surface vessels for maritime autonomy.

Founded in 2018, Red Cat thrives on innovation, reliability, and collaborative advancement. Our Teal team operates from a leading U.S. manufacturing facility in Salt Lake City, Utah, pushing the boundaries of American-made drone production.

We value user-friendly, rugged, and interoperable technologies designed for high-stakes operations. At Red Cat, we build scalable systems that empower operators with real-time, actionable intelligence.

Red Cat is seeking a full-time IT Specialist to support and grow our internal IT capabilities. You'll join a fast-paced team creating world-class unmanned aircraft systems (UAS) for defense, public safety, and government sectors.

Position Summary

This is an onsite position at Red Cat’s FlightWave facility in Carson, California. Some travel to the Salt Lake City, Utah facility will be required. The IT Specialist will assist in maintaining Red Cat’s IT infrastructure—ensuring performance, security, and user support. Serving as the IT Department’s head representative to FlightWave, this hands-on role includes technical troubleshooting, onboarding/offboarding, system upkeep, and collaborating with senior IT staff to improve processes and maintain compliance. While this role will work from California, much of Red Cat’s staff is remote and located throughout the United States. This role will assist FlightWave, Teal Drones, Red Cat and other business divisions as needed.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ities

  • Collaboration
    • The role will participate in IT Department stand-ups with remote staff
    • Documents systems of FlightWave to increase knowledge of those systems for Red Cat IT Department.
    • Works with FlightWave management and Red Cat IT Director to plan and manage deployment of new systems and procedures.
  • Technical Support
    • Provide Tier 1 and Tier 2 support for hardware, software, and network issues across Windows, macOS, and Linux systems
    • Respond to helpdesk tickets in a timely manner, document resolutions, and escalate complex issues as needed
    • Troubleshoot desktop, laptop, peripheral, and printer issues for local and remote users
    • Support mobile device configurations, VPN access, and remote connectivity tools
  • User Onboarding/Offboarding
    • Setup of accounts, permissions, and hardware/software for new hires
    • Conduct IT orientation sessions
    • Coordinate with IT Staff and HR on onboarding/offboarding checklists and timelines
    • Communicate logistical needs to the IT Director to ensure on time delivery of equipment
  • System Maintenance
    • Apply routine updates, patches, and backups on endpoints and some server systems under supervision
    • User account and access management
    • Assist in monitoring infrastructure health and logging performance anomalies
    • Maintain asset inventory and ensure system compliance with internal configuration standards
  • Infrastructure Support
    • Desktop, server, and network device support
    • Provide hands-on support for network-connected devices, cabling, and rack-mounted hardware
    • Assist with basic firewall, switch, and wireless configuration tasks (Ubiquiti, Fortinet, etc.)
    • Support basic VMware/Proxmox virtualization tasks under direction of senior staff
  • Security
    • Support compliance and audit readiness
    • Enforce and Support IT security procedures such as MFA enrollment, password policies, and endpoint security
  • Documentation & Reporting
    • Maintain up-to-date technical documentation for internal procedures and troubleshooting guides
    • Contribute to internal knowledgebase articles for common support scenarios
    • Participate in internal IT meetings and project planning sessions as a supporting team member
  • Project Assistance
    • Collaborate on system upgrades and deployments
  • Training and Development
    • Pursue certifications and stay informed on enterprise IT and cybersecurity trends
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in IT or 8 years relevant experience
  • Demonstrated ability to handle Tier 1 and Tier 2 support tasks independently, escalate when appropriate, and clearly document troubleshooting steps
  • Proficient with Windows and Linux operating systems at an administrative level, including user profile management, system updates, configuration, and debugging of applications
  • Familiarity with user creation procedures within a medium-sized business.
  • Experience with identity and access management in Microsoft 365, Google Workspace, and/or Active Directory environments
  • Knowledge of Network protocols and services such as TCP/IP, DNS, and HTTP
  • Ability to configure and support wired and wireless networks, including experience configuring VLAN, Firewall Rules
  • Previous use and configuration of VPN clients
  • Hands-on experience with endpoint and workstation deployment, imaging, and standard configuration management practices
  • Familiarity with virtualization platforms such as VMware or Proxmox, with the ability to support basic administrative tasks
  • Comfortable creating and using PowerShell or Python scripting to automate repeatable processes
  • Strong communication and problem-solving skills
